Durham's daily fact for dogs

Our climate swings. July and August bring long strings of days above 90 degrees with pavement that french fries paws quickly. Pollen spikes can set off itch flare ups in springtime. We additionally get cold wave with freezing rainfall that turn pathways slippery. Excellent canine pedestrians plan around all of it. They start previously in warmth, use shaded greenways like Sandy Creek Park, carry water, switch to sniffy decompression strolls in tree cover, and shorten noontime stretches if needed. When ice hits, they select dog walk services Durham more secure paths, wipe paws, and expect salt irritation.

The built environment shapes choices also. Midtown has tighter pathways and even more sound. Woodcroft and Hope Valley deal calmer dead ends and loops with fully grown trees. The American Cigarette Path is fantastic for directly, steady gas mileage, however it can be active with bikes. A savvy dog walker checks out the map, after that reviews your pet dog, and integrates both to get the appropriate kind of exercise.

The leading 7 benefits of working with an expert dog walker in Durham

1. Constant, reproduce suitable exercise that fits the season

Every canine needs motion, but not the exact same kind or dose. A 9 years of age bulldog does not need what a 10 month old Aussie needs. A specialist dog walking solution brings that calibration. In summer season, my pedestrians in Durham change high drive herding types to questionable, stop and sniff routes near Third Fork Creek in the late early morning, then do any type of cardiovascular operate in the cooler evening port. Senior dogs obtain short, constant potty breaks with mild walks and remainder. On light loss days, we extend duration and surface, making use of leaf litter and new aromas as brain work. Over a month, that equilibrium of intensity and rest improves stamina without straining joints or getting too hot, especially critical on humid days that endanger cooling.

2. Midday relief, healthier digestion, fewer accidents

Gastrointestinal comfort and bladder wellness enhance with regular relief. Young puppies under 6 months hardly ever make it longer than 4 hours without a break, no matter just how much you want they could. Numerous adult canines can hold it, but at an expense, specifically elders or those on particular medicines. Trustworthy noontime walks minimize urinary system system infection danger and assist manage defecation. In my notes, families with a regular 20 to thirty minutes midday stroll saw indoor crashes go down to near no within two weeks, even for just recently embraced pets that were still resolving in. That predictability decreases stress and anxiety and prevents the sort of agitated energy that builds when a pet needs to wait as well long.

3. Better actions through targeted mental work

A tired pet dog is a myth if all you do is run them up until their legs totter. The brain needs a work. Good dog walkers use scent games at trailheads, pattern video games at peaceful edges, and easy impulse control on leash to bring arousal down, then keep it there. We will certainly ask for a sit and eye contact at busy crosswalks on Ninth Street, benefit calm while a bus passes, and step off the pathway for room if a skateboard methods. Ten intentional repeatings done well issue greater than a frantic mile. With time, pulling reduces, sensitivity softens, and your pet finds out exactly how to recuperate from abrupt noise or crowds. That pays off in reality, like exterior dishes at Geer Street or waiting in line at a veterinarian clinic.

4. Social confidence without chaos

Everyone images their pet dog going for a park with a loads new buddies. Some thrive there, some get overloaded, and a couple of learn negative behaviors fast. Professional pet dog walkers in Durham, NC manage social exposure strategically. If a dog delights in business, we combine suitable walking pals by dimension, power, and chain manners, keep groups tiny, and choose routes with adequate width for comfy alongside motion, like sections of Battle each other Woodland where permitted. For pets affordable dog walking Durham that choose room, we arrange solo strolls and course them at off peak times. The result is social confidence built on positive, regulated experiences, not compelled proximity.

5. Early detection of health and wellness concerns and safer walks

Walkers spend time seeing your canine action, sniff, and eliminate daily. That rep reveals small modifications. We discover the head bob that suggests a sore wrist, a brand-new drawback in the hips on stairs, the means a generally steady stomach creates soft stool two days running. A text with a quick video clip often triggers a preventive vet visit that saves bigger trouble later on. Safety recognition expands beyond the pet. Durham has city wildlife, from hawks to the weird prairie wolf discovery at dawn near wooded sides. We keep canines on leash per neighborhood guidelines, check for foxtails and burrs, carry tick cleaners, and prevent hot asphalt at lunchtime. I have actually rescheduled walks to shaded loops a lot more times than I can count when a warm advisory hit, and owners thanked me later.

6. Real benefit for challenging schedules

Shifts transform. A meeting runs long. A youngster wakes up with a fever. A pet strolling solution takes in that changability. A lot of established canine pedestrians in Durham provide timetable home windows, very same day add if you schedule early, and app based updates. You obtain a GPS map, a couple of images, and a brief note regarding mood, poop, and anything remarkable. Even if you remain in a laboratory or scrubbed in, you can glance at your phone and know your pet dog is covered. The mental lift is genuine. Clients commonly say the updates help them focus at the office, after that stroll in the door all set to take pleasure in the night as opposed to shuffle to repair a mess.

7. A calmer home life

When a dog's demands are met dependably, they bark less at squirrels, chew less footwear, and resolve faster after dinner. That changes the feeling of the house. I think of one couple in Trinity Park whose young vizsla groaned whenever they left. We established a 30 minute sniff stroll at 11, then a 15 minute potty brake with 2 short training video games at 3. Within three weeks, their neighbors stopped texting concerning sound. They started welcoming pals over once again. The dog learned that daily has beats, and anxiety lost its grip.

What an expert pet dog strolling service generally supplies in Durham

Service food selections differ, yet you will see patterns throughout the much better canine strolling services in Durham, NC. Standard see sizes hover at 20, 30, and 60 mins. Some provide 45 mins, which works well in severe climate or for pets that do best with a brisk loop and a couple of mins of interior play. Many firms make use of a scheduling application that validates time windows, logs the stroll route, and allows you upgrade feeding or drug notes.

Solo strolls suit reactive, senior, or clinically intricate pets. Combined or tiny group walks can reduce price and add risk-free social time, however ask what team size indicates in technique. I hardly ever see greater than 2 pets per walker on city sidewalks. 3 is a hard limitation I advise for tracks with vast courses. Off leash experiences sound amazing, yet true off chain is uncommon in Durham as a result of leash laws and safety and security. A reputable dog walker will certainly maintain your pet dog leashed unless on private property with approval, and they will certainly tell you that up front.

Expect basic gear administration, like wiping paws after rain, refreshing water, and towel drying if needed. Most walkers lug a tiny set, poop bags, spare slip lead, a foldable water bowl, and paw balm in winter months. Keys are stored in lockboxes or coded systems, and insurance policy needs to cover vital loss. If your pet needs midday medication, validate the service's plan on administering pills or decreases. Lots of will certainly do it, yet they will certainly want an authorized direction sheet and perhaps a fast demo.

Pricing in context, and what impacts it

Rates relocate with experience, insurance policy, and visit length. In Durham, a 20 minute see usually lands between 18 and 28 bucks, a 30 minute visit between 22 and 35 dollars, and a 60 minute see between 35 and 55 bucks. Add like a 2nd dog can be a little cost, often 3 to 8 dollars, depending on the size and handling demands. Weekend break, vacation, or late evening slots might lug additional charges. Solo responsive pet outings cost more than an easygoing paired walk, not since anyone is penalizing the pet, yet due to the fact that 2 hands, two eyes, and a wide buffer are dedicated to one animal.

Be careful of rates that seem as well reduced. Workers need training, time extra padding for emergencies, and rest. A sustainable pet strolling solution pays relatively, preserves insurance policy, and can soak up the periodic puncture without canceling your canine's day.

How to select the very best dog walker in Durham, NC

Plenty of search engine result show up when you type dog walker Durham NC. Sorting them takes judgment, and you do not require a postgraduate degree to do it well. Begin with insurance coverage and experience, after that enjoy how a pedestrian communicates with your pet dog and with you. Take notice of the tiny points, like preparation at the fulfill and welcome and the clarity of their interaction. Ask for recommendations from clients with canines comparable to your own, not just glowing generalities.

Here is a portable checklist that maintains the basics front and center:

  • Proof of service insurance coverage, bonding, and employees' compensation if they have employees, plus a clear plan for tricks or lockboxes.
  • Training method that utilizes rewards and humane handling, with specifics on exactly how they manage drawing, barking, or abrupt lunges.
  • Experience with your pet dog's profile, as an example, big teenage pet dogs, senior citizens with arthritis, or chain reactive dogs.
  • Clear visit structure, timing windows, and backup strategy if your main pedestrian is sick or stuck, with GPS or picture updates.
  • Transparent prices, termination terms, holiday additional charges, and just how they manage extreme warm, tornados, or ice.

When you fulfill, see your dog. An excellent walker provides a canine space to sniff and come close to initially, kneels sideways as opposed to impending, and prevents rough patting as soon as possible. They take care of chains smoothly, inspect harness fit, and ask where your dog likes to go. If your pet is timid or reactive, a quiet very first visit without pressure to stroll far may be the right call.

Local context that matters more than you think

Durham and neighboring districts enforce leash and family pet waste pick-up policies. An expert need to discuss this without prompting. Ask exactly how they route on warm days, rainy days, and throughout fallen leave pickup when walkways get obstructed. In summertime, shaded routes along creeks or in older areas with high trees make an actual distinction for brachycephalic types. In winter months, some pathways remain icy long after the sunlight strikes others, especially on north dealing with hills. People that walk daily in your part of town recognize where the risk-free ground is.

Traffic timing is one more quiet element. Around institutions, dismissal home windows create collections of cars and trucks and kids with mobility scooters, which can alarm noise sensitive pets. A walker that recognizes to move 20 minutes earlier that week is worth their fee.

Interview questions and five subtle red flags

You will have your very own checklist of concerns. Add a couple of that action beyond the web site gloss. Ask them to define a recent stroll that did licensed Durham dog walking not go to strategy and what they transformed. Ask exactly how they would certainly heat up a high power dog on a humid day to stay clear of getting too hot. Request for a brief trial of exactly how they manage a pull toward a squirrel. Answers that sound resided in are what you want.

Watch for these red flags that commonly forecast migraines later on:

  • Vague or dismissive responses concerning insurance or emergency situation planning.
  • Reliance on aversive tools without your consent, such as sliding prong collars or utilizing leash stands out as a default.
  • Overpromising, like walking four or 5 pets at the same time on midtown walkways, or assuring that a responsive pet dog will certainly be great in large teams within a week.
  • Thin interaction, late replies throughout the trial week, or irregular stroll home windows with no heads up.
  • Indifference to weather changes, like demanding lengthy lunchtime asphalt walks during a warmth advisory.

Three typical scenarios, and just how a great dog walker adapts

A 6 month old pup in Lakewood. Potty training is mainly there, yet lunchtime is unsteady. The pedestrian establishes 2 noontime brows through for the initial 2 weeks, a 15 min alleviation at 11 and a 20 minute stroll at 2 with two straightforward training games. They reduce the walk on warm days, offer water, and log each pee and poop. Within a month, the owner drops to one half an hour noontime visit since the canine is dependably holding weekend dog walking services between 10 and 3.

A reactive guard near Southpoint. The pet dog aggresses bikes and joggers. The walker selects quieter streets at 10 a.m., after that uses distance from triggers, satisfying check ins. They keep the pet dog at the edge of comfort and never ever press with reactivity. Over four to six weeks, the shepherd can pass a jogger at 30 feet without barking, after that 20 feet. Not ideal, but convenient, and the owner really feels risk-free again.

An elderly beagle midtown with creaky hips. Stairs are tough in the morning. The pedestrian times sees after discomfort medications, utilizes a rear harness help if needed, and selects flat loopholes with yard shoulders. They massage therapy paws after icy days and spray a little water on the stomach throughout warmth. The pet dog returns home material, not hopping, and the owner's vet reports secure weight and far better mobility.

Working partnership, just how to make it smooth

Start with a clear account. reliable dog walking services Include routines, health notes, where the harness hangs, how to prevent the neighbor's yappy fence line, and your pet dog's favorite reward. Pedestrians relocate faster and more secure when they do not need to think. Set practical time windows and pick a key access system that does not call for daily coordination. Throughout the initial week, check the app notes, reply if something looks off, and deal responses. 2 or 3 tiny program corrections early on avoid longer term drift from your preferences.

If your timetable whipsaws, bundle adjustments when you can. Lots of pet strolling solutions plan courses the evening before. A single message which contains all week updates beats a string of individual pings. Maintain emergency situation calls current. If you know a storm is coming, preauthorize the walker to reduce outdoor time and extend interior enrichment, like nose work with a few deals with concealed under cups.

Most pet dogs benefit from uniformity, yet a small amount of novelty keeps them interested. Every week or two, ask the walker to choose a new loophole or include a brief pattern game at the end. That tweak invigorates the brain without ramping arousal.

The function of training and boundaries

A dog walker is not a substitute for a fitness instructor, yet a competent walker reinforces the guidelines you establish. If you are teaching loose chain strolling, agree on cues and incentives. If your canine can not welcome on leash, the pedestrian ought to mirror that limit and reroute with a simple sit and treat as various other pets pass. When every person manages the dog the same way, progress sticks.

Be thoughtful about equipment. Harnesses that clip at the breast can lower pulling for some pets and intensify motion for others. Collars need to have 2 finger slack, harness bands ought to rest clear of shoulder blades. Share your vet's suggestions on orthopedic issues or any kind of constraints. The best pet pedestrians durham has will certainly ask to adjust the plan if they see chafing or if stride changes after 15 minutes.

Where to look, and exactly how to verify

Referrals still beat formulas. Ask your vet technology, your next-door neighbor with the calm Lab, your structure manager. Much of the constant pet walking solutions Durham NC citizens rely upon keep a reduced marketing profile since they are scheduled with word of mouth. If you do browse online, combine "pet dog strolling solution Durham" with your neighborhood name. Review testimonials, but evaluate specifics over star counts. A review that states, "They rerouted to shade throughout last week's heat advisory and brought added water for my pug," is worth 10 common raves.

Schedule a paid trial week before making a regular monthly dedication. Schedule 3 to five visits across various times. Review preparation within the agreed home window, the top quality of notes, just how your pet dog greets the walker on day 3, and whether little concerns get smoothed rapidly. If your canine returns loosened up, beverages water, after that naps, you get on track. If your pet dog rotates at the door for an hour after the pedestrian leaves, or you see placing sensitivity, readjust or reconsider.

Weather, security, and realistic expectations

Durham summer seasons will test also healthy pet dogs. On 95 degree days with high humidity, your dog does not need range, they need secure interaction. A 15 to 20 min shaded smell walk with water and a cool off towel within is usually the best telephone call. Great solutions interact these changes and do not excuse shielding your pet. Furthermore, throughout thunderstorms, several canines stop at the door. Compeling them out creates battles. A walker needs to pivot to interior enrichment, potty if possible during lulls, and maintain you informed.

Traffic and construction change promptly around below. Pathway closures pop up without caution. I have actually transformed a scheduled loophole into a dead end figure just to avoid a loud backhoe. The metric is not miles, it is quality. If your pet dog gets five solid minutes of loose leash practice, three tranquil direct exposures to delivery trucks, and a tidy potty break, that is a successful midday visit on a loud day.
